Before talking about this Kenwood rice cooker, I would like to talk about cooking rice from an eastern perspective.
Growing up in the Far East, it is hard for me to imagine why a lot of western people boil rice in large quantity of water and throw the water away (I know rice is cooked differently in places like Italy or Spain but I'm not going into that). Our mothers always told us that by doing the above, all the flavour and nutrients are gone ... ...looked around and bought this Kenwood rice cooker. This can cook up to 6 cups of rice, which means 12 portions.
The rice cooker comes in 3 parts. Outside is a white ceramic type of pot with a round metal right in the centre at the bottom, which is the heating devise. Inside is a non-stick bowl where you put the rice in. Finally, it's the glass lid which you can see through. The cord is not detachable.

i recently bought a morphy richards slow cooker (on recommendations from various websites) and i have to say if you really love cooking you wont like using a slow cooker or the results . if however you are very busy and need the convenience of food being cooked while you are out at work or shopping then you will probably find the results acceptable.
Personally i dont like cooking in the morning, just a personal thing i know but you have to start ... ...cooking you are not supposed to lift off the lid because all the heat goes out and you have to extend the cooking time. So how do you taste it and alter it or improve it if you can't take off the lid. My main problem with it is that although it makes the meat tender it all ends up half boiled / half steamed and lacking in a concentration of flavour that cooking in the oven in a cast iron casserole dish provides.
